Ingredients You Need
- 4 salmon fillets: Rich in Omega-3 fatty acids, essential for heart health.
- 8 oz cream cheese, softened: Adds creaminess and calcium for healthy bones.
- 2 cups fresh spinach, chopped: High in iron and vitamins A and K, supporting overall health.
- 1/2 cup grated Parmesan cheese: Enhances flavor and provides additional calcium.
- 2 cloves garlic, minced: Offers anti-inflammatory properties and boosts flavor.
- 1 tablespoon lemon juice: Brightens the dish and adds Vitamin C for immune support.
- 1 teaspoon salt: Essential for flavor enhancement.
- 1/2 teaspoon black pepper: Adds a slight kick to the dish.
- 1 tablespoon olive oil: Provides healthy fats and enhances cooking flavor.
How to Make Stuffed Salmon Step by Step
- Preheat your oven to 375°F (190°C).
- In a mixing bowl, combine the softened cream cheese, chopped spinach, grated Parmesan cheese, minced garlic, lemon juice, salt, and pepper. Mix until well combined.
- Place the salmon fillets on a baking sheet lined with parchment paper. Using a sharp knife, make a pocket in each fillet.
- Stuff each salmon fillet with the cream cheese and spinach mixture, pressing gently to secure the filling.
- Drizzle olive oil over the stuffed salmon and season with additional salt and pepper if desired.
- Bake in the preheated oven for 20 minutes, or until the salmon is cooked through and flakes easily with a fork.
- Remove from the oven and let rest for a few minutes before serving.
Pro Tip: Ensure the cream cheese is at room temperature for easier mixing.
Pro Tip: Use a meat thermometer to check the internal temperature; it should reach 145°F (63°C).
Expert Tips for Best Results
- Choose fresh wild-caught salmon for the best flavor and quality.
- Feel free to add herbs such as dill or parsley to the stuffing for an extra flavor boost.
- For a crispy topping, broil the salmon for the last 2-3 minutes of cooking.
- If you prefer a lighter version, substitute cream cheese with Greek yogurt.
- Serve with a side of roasted vegetables or over a bed of quinoa for a complete meal.
- Store leftovers in an airtight container in the fridge for up to 3 days.

How to Serve and Store
Serve your stuffed salmon with lemon wedges for a fresh burst of flavor. Pair it with steamed vegetables or a light salad for a balanced meal. As for storage, you can keep leftovers in the fridge for up to 3 days in an airtight container. This dish can be frozen, but it’s best to consume it fresh. If freezing, store it properly in a freezer-safe bag for up to 2 months. For reheating, place it in the oven at 350°F (175°C) until warmed through to maintain its texture.
Frequently Asked Questions
Can I use frozen salmon for this recipe?
Yes, but thaw it completely before stuffing and cooking.
How can I tell when the salmon is done?
The salmon should reach an internal temperature of 145°F (63°C) when fully cooked.
What can I substitute for spinach?
You can use kale or Swiss chard as alternatives for spinach.
Can I prepare the filling in advance?
Yes, you can prepare the filling a day ahead and store it in the refrigerator.
Is this recipe gluten-free?
Yes, all the ingredients in this recipe are gluten-free.
What is the best way to reheat stuffed salmon?
Reheat in the oven at 350°F (175°C) for the best texture.

Ingredients
- 4 salmon fillets
- 8 oz cream cheese, softened
- 2 cups fresh spinach, chopped
- 1/2 cup grated Parmesan cheese
- 2 cloves garlic, minced
- 1 tablespoon lemon juice
- 1 teaspoon salt
- 1/2 teaspoon black pepper
- 1 tablespoon olive oil
Instructions
- Preheat your oven to 375°F (190°C).
- In a medium bowl, combine the cream cheese, chopped spinach, Parmesan cheese, minced garlic, lemon juice, salt, and pepper. Mix until well combined.
- Using a sharp knife, create a pocket in each salmon fillet by cutting horizontally, being careful not to cut all the way through.
- Stuff each salmon fillet with the cream cheese and spinach mixture, using toothpicks to secure the edges if necessary.
- Heat olive oil in a large oven-safe skillet over medium heat. Sear the stuffed salmon fillets for about 3-4 minutes on each side until golden brown.
- Transfer the skillet to the preheated oven and bake for an additional 10-15 minutes, or until the salmon is cooked through and flakes easily with a fork.
- Remove from the oven and let cool for a few minutes before serving. Enjoy!
